    Not enough credit can go to those who spend the time on the wall doing timing, it is not a good job, but as teams we would be knackered without them. Our 2 people, Mark and Sam did a fantastic job and we can't thank them enough.

    Our 12th was a disappointment, we only broke out 4 times for the whole team, which was big for us. We were a bit behind the 8 ball as we had pretty fast cars since they bought the maximum lap time up to 1.40 from 1,35 last year, a lot of fast cars were not allowed in and that meant that we were one of the faster teams. Our bloke in the Cobra was doing 1.40.05's on Saturday, but nominated 1.41. All the rest of us (all V8 assault) nominated 1.45's.

    All this meant was that we had a lot of traffic to contend with so we found it really difficult to acheive our nominated lap times as we were running slow of it all the time. Something to mull over for next year,
